Abstract
The various categories of cations & anions and purification of ionic liquids are reviewed. The intrinsic properties of ionic liquids make purification difficult and therefore a special emphasis is placed on currently employed purification methodologies together with ionic liquid impurities. For the same reason highlighted above characterization of ionic liquid impurities presents unique challenges; the available methods and some of the issues of their use are also reviewed. This chapter gives a survey on the pilot plants and industrial processes of ionic liquids. Moreover, challenges, issues, and recycling methods of ionic liquids in industrial developments are also discussed.
